WebAug 8, 2013 · Crypt abscesses: Crypts, or crypts of Lieberkühn, are mucosal crevices that are seen in the normal gastrointestinal tract. In … WebNov 20, 2024 · Active colitis refers to the presence of neutrophils either in the lamina propria, in crypt epithelium (cryptitis) or within the lumen, forming small abscesses (crypt abscesses). Neutrophils confined to the lumen of mucosal vessels are not considered part of the process of active colitis. A predominantly neutrophilic infiltrate without significant …

WebA crypt abscess is a related change that means the neutrophils have filled the open space normally found in the center of the crypt. What is the main cause of colitis?
